Description

1,2-Dipalmitoyl-α-Phosphatidyl-3-(4-Methoxyphenyl)Umbelliferone is a specialized synthetic phospholipid derivative, engineered for advanced research and development applications. This compound is valued for its unique structure, which combines a fluorescent umbelliferone moiety with a dipalmitoyl phosphatidyl backbone, enabling its use as a sophisticated probe or building block. It is primarily utilized by researchers and product developers in the pharmaceutical, biotechnology, and advanced materials sectors for applications such as membrane studies, fluorescence labeling, and the development of novel diagnostic or delivery systems.

Application

  • Fluorescent Membrane Probe: Used in biophysical research to study lipid bilayer dynamics, membrane fluidity, and protein-lipid interactions due to its built-in fluorophore.
  • Liposome & Drug Delivery System Development: Serves as a functionalized phospholipid component for creating targeted or traceable liposomal carriers for therapeutic agents.
  • Biochemical Assay Reagent: Acts as a substrate or tracer in enzymatic assays, particularly those involving phospholipases or other lipid-modifying enzymes.
  • Cell Biology & Imaging: Employed for fluorescent labeling of cellular membranes in live-cell imaging and microscopy studies.
  • Advanced Material Synthesis: Used as a building block for synthesizing novel biomimetic polymers or surface coatings with specific optical properties.
  • Diagnostic Kit Component: Incorporated into the development of fluorescence-based diagnostic tests and biosensors.

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store at -20°C or below under desiccant (e.g., in a sealed container with silica gel) to minimize hydrolysis and degradation. This product is hygroscopic (moisture-sensitive) and light-sensitive. Allow the sealed vial to equilibrate to room temperature before opening to prevent condensation.
